Promote Reforms for Easier and More Accessible
Registration & Voting

Reform absentee voting

  • Permit unconditional absentee voting by amending the Massachusetts Constitution

  • Allow early absentee voting at municipal election offices before an election

Allow Election Day registration

  • Increase turnout by allowing voter registration at polling places

  • Lessen the need for confusing and time-consuming provisional ballots

Increase accessibility of voter registration forms

  • Allow downloading and photocopying of forms

  • Promote changes to make the forms more user-friendly

Establish online access to voting lists

  • Allow voters across the state to check their voter registration status online

  • Ensure that online voter registration records are kept accurate and up-to-date

Expand right to leave work to vote

  • Amend existing law to allow all workers to take a two-hour leave to vote if they do not have three consecutive hours away from work when polls are open

Ensure that Voting is Equitable and Efficient
Oppose restrictive identification requirements

  • Ensure that requirements for presenting IDs, which can be discriminatory, are not expanded

Expand recruitment of poll workers

  • Allow municipalities to hire poll workers residing in other towns and cities, including college students, and to reassign public employees to serve as poll workers

  • Permit hiring high school students to serve as poll workers

Mandate display of Voters' Bill of Rights in every polling place

  • Voters should have easy access to the Voters' Bill of Rights so they can protect their rights at the polls.

Boost Voter Confidence in Electoral System and Elected Officials
Propose measures to ensure the continuing impartiality of elections administration

  • File legislation to ensure that election administrators are impartial by barring them from holding responsible, fiduciary positions in political campaigns other than their own
